This engine was assembled with Manley 5.0 stroker internals, Fox Lake CNC ported heads, 120 lbs Valve springs, and custom Todd Warren Cams. The engine ran perfect at first and then had a bad knock after it would get to operating temperature. It almost sounded like a rod knock but it ended up being the cam phasers. With the increase in lift and valve spring pressure the VCT solenoids couldn’t control the phasers. Some Blow By Racing cam phaser lock outs fixed the problem.
